Gandhinagar, April 14 (IANS) President Droupadi Murmu on Tuesday said that cyber security, data protection and digital diplomacy have become as critical as conventional military strength, while addressing the fifth convocation ceremony of Rashtriya Raksha University (RRU) in Gujarat. She said the very nature of national security has transformed in the digital age, with cybercrime, phishing attacks and data breaches emerging as major challenges before the country.“Cyber security is now not only…
Gandhinagar, April 14 (IANS) National Security Advisor (NSA) Ajit Doval on Tuesday said that national security ultimately depends on the morale of the nation and its citizens’ awareness, stressing that it cannot be defined solely by military strength or technological capability but must be understood as a collective national responsibility. Addressing the fifth convocation ceremony of Rashtriya Raksha University (RRU) in Gujarat after being conferred an honorary doctorate by President Droupadi M…
